La simulation multi-coeur et  l’édition rapide dans PragmaDev Process V3.1

La simulation multi-coeur et l’édition rapide dans PragmaDev Process V3.1

10 octobre 2023

PragmaDev Process permet de vérifier et d’optimiser les processus métier décrits avec la notation BPMN (Business Process Model and Notation). La nouvelle version de l’outil tire avantage des architectures multi-coeur des processeurs et introduit des fonctionnalités d’édition rapide des modèles.

Les organisations ou les systèmes complexes sont basés sur des processus qui peuvent être décrits dans des modèles graphiques. La notation standard la plus populaire pour cela est le BPMN. Elle permet de décrire les activités des différents participants dans une organisation et comment ils interagissent.

La version 2.0 de l’outil PragmaDev Process a introduit un simulateur statistique de la performance du processus, et la version 3.0 a introduit la gestion des ressources associées au processus. Du fait de la nature statistique de la simulation un nombre conséquent de réplications est nécessaire pour faire converger les résultats. La simulation de grands modèles peut de ce fait s’avérer longue. La version 3.1 tire avantage de l’architecture des processeurs actuels avec la simulation multi-coeur pour les grands modèles. A noter que les résultats de simulation ne dépendent pas du nombre de coeurs utilisés pour la simulation.

Du fait du nombre important de symboles à disposition, l’édition de modèles de processus BPMN peut s’avérer chronophage. La version 3.1 introduit des poignées sur les symboles pour un accès rapide aux catégories et finalement à l’élément que l’on cherche à ajouter au processus. Aussi les conteneurs comme les Participants et les Lignes s’ajustent automatiquement à la nouvelle taille du processus quand un élément est ajouté. Enfin la taille du conteneur Participant s’ajuste automatiquement quand des Lignes sont ajoutées. Toutes ces fonctionnalités d’édition accélèrent substantiellement l’édition de modèles de processus.

En savoir plus sur PragmaDev Process

process_fr_v3.0.png